Sign in
Rewards
Search
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Real Estate
Notebook
rams philadelphia news
Shree Rams's News
Newspaper & magazines store in Philadelphia, United States
Save
Share
More
Directions
Nearby
Location closed
601 Market St, Philadelphia, Pa 19106
(215) 922-3870
Oops! Something went wrong, please try again later.
Suggest an edit
·
Your business?
Claim now
People also search for
Bookstore
Head House Books
Mapquest.com (39)
Molly's Books & Records
Facebook (34)
Brickbat Books
Facebook (18)
Mostly Books
Tripadvisor (3)
Bauman Rare Books
Nicelocal.com (12)
Comic books store
The Comic Book Store
Facebook (319)
Crossroad Comics and Collectibles
Facebook (60)
Cult Fiction Comics
Facebook (20)
Uncanny!
Facebook (13)
Nearby
Search nearby
Save to calendar
Streetside
Bird's Eye